Weather in January

January, the same as December, is another warm winter month in La Maya, Cuba, with an average temperature ranging between max 27.8°C (82°F) and min 19.3°C (66.7°F).

Temperature

The lowest temperatures are recorded in January, with averages reaching a high of 27.8°C (82°F) and a low of 19.3°C (66.7°F).

Heat index

The heat index value for January is estimated at a hot 32°C (89.6°F). Prolonged exposure combined with continuous activity could lead to exhaustion, and possibly heat cramps.
Know that the heat index computations account for shaded terrains and slight winds. When under direct sunshine, the heat index may be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'real feel', is a measure that combines air temperature and relative humidity into a single value that indicates how hot the weather feels. The effect is personal, with varied weather perceptions among individuals due to differences in body mass, stature, and physical activity. Direct sun rays can make one feel hotter,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ical to babies and toddlers. Typically, young kids are at a higher risk than adults since they sweat less. Also, the larger skin surface in proportion to their small bodies and the heightened heat production due to their active nature adds to their vulnerability.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in January is 80%.

Rainfall

In January, in La Maya, the rain falls for 12.9 days. Throughout January, 23mm (0.91") of precipitation is accumulated. In La Maya, during the entire year, the rain falls for 242.5 days and collects up to 898mm (35.35")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January is 11h and 4min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:37 and sunset at 17:34.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 06:38 and sunset at 17:53 CST.

Sunshine

In La Maya, the average sunshine in January is 7h.

UV index

January through April,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index in La Maya.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: The daily high UV index of 6 during January translates into the following recommendations:
Prevent overexposure. Protection from the sun's harmful effects is needed. Limit direct sun exposure especially between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. However, keep in mind that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. To cut down UV radiation exposure by about half, sport a wide-brim hat.
